    Methods to Obtain Your iAcademic Transcript in English

    Alright, let's talk about the different ways you can get your iAcademic transcript translated into English. You've basically got a few options to choose from, each with its own set of pros and cons. Understanding these methods will help you pick the one that best fits your needs and budget. First up, you can go directly to your educational institution. Many universities and colleges offer official translation services. This is often the most straightforward and reliable option. The institution's translation services are typically familiar with the format and content of academic transcripts, ensuring an accurate and consistent translation. Plus, the translated transcript is often certified by the institution, adding an extra layer of credibility. However, this method can sometimes be more expensive and may take longer compared to other options. The turnaround time can vary depending on the institution's workload and the complexity of your transcript. So, if you're on a tight deadline or budget, you might want to explore other alternatives.

    Next, you can hire a professional translation service. There are tons of translation agencies and freelance translators out there who specialize in academic document translation. These services often offer competitive rates and faster turnaround times. When choosing a translation service, make sure to do your research and select a reputable provider with experience in translating academic transcripts. Look for reviews and testimonials from other customers to gauge the quality of their work. It's also a good idea to ask for samples of their previous translations to ensure they meet your standards. A professional translation service can provide you with a certified translation that is accepted by universities, employers, and immigration authorities. Just be sure to verify their credentials and ensure they have a thorough understanding of academic terminology. This method can be a great option if you need a quick and reliable translation without breaking the bank.

    Finally, you can use online translation tools. While this might seem like the easiest and cheapest option, it's generally not recommended for official documents like academic transcripts. Online translation tools, such as Google Translate, can be useful for getting a general idea of the content, but they often produce inaccurate and unreliable translations. Academic transcripts contain specific terminology and formatting that require a human translator with expertise in the field. Using an online translation tool for your iAcademic transcript could result in errors and misinterpretations, which could negatively impact your application or job prospects. Therefore, it's best to avoid this method for official purposes. In summary, while there are several methods to obtain your iAcademic transcript in English, it's important to choose the one that provides the most accurate and reliable translation. Going directly to your educational institution or hiring a professional translation service are generally the best options for ensuring the quality and credibility of your translated transcript.

    Key Considerations When Choosing a Translation Service

    Choosing the right translation service for your iAcademic transcript is super important, guys. Here are some key things to keep in mind to make sure you get it right. First off, accuracy is everything. You need to make sure that the translation service you pick is known for providing accurate translations. Academic transcripts are packed with specific terms and grades, and even a small mistake can change the meaning and mess up your application. Look for services that use translators who are experts in academics and know their stuff when it comes to the subject matter in your transcript. Checking reviews and testimonials can give you a good idea of how accurate their work usually is. Don't be afraid to ask them about their process for making sure translations are correct, like if they have a second person review the work. Getting an accurate translation is not just about getting the words right; it's about making sure the translation matches the original document in terms of tone and detail.

    Certification is another big one. For many official purposes, like applying to universities or jobs, you'll need a certified translation. This means that the translation comes with a statement from the translation service saying it's complete and accurate. The certification often includes the translator's signature and credentials, which adds weight to the document. Make sure the translation service you're thinking about offers certification and that it meets the standards of the places you'll be submitting the transcript to. The rules for certified translations can be different depending on where you are sending the document, so do your homework. Not all translation services are created equal when it comes to certification, so double-check that they know what they're doing.

    Turnaround time and cost are also things you'll want to think about. How quickly do you need the translation, and how much are you willing to spend? Different services will have different prices and turnaround times, so shop around to find one that fits your schedule and budget. Keep in mind that faster service usually means a higher cost. It's also a good idea to get quotes from a few different services before making a decision. But don't just go for the cheapest option. Quality is more important than saving a few bucks, especially when it comes to something as important as your iAcademic transcript. Sometimes, paying a bit more for a reliable service can save you headaches and problems in the long run. So, weigh your options carefully and find the right balance between cost, speed, and quality.

    Tips for Ensuring a Smooth Translation Process

    To wrap things up, here are some tips to help make sure the translation process goes smoothly. Firstly, provide clear and complete information to the translation service. The more information you provide, the better the translator can understand your needs and deliver an accurate translation. This includes providing a clear copy of your iAcademic transcript, along with any specific instructions or requirements. If there are any abbreviations or acronyms in your transcript that might not be familiar to the translator, be sure to provide a glossary or explanation. Similarly, if there are any specific terms or phrases that you want to be translated in a particular way, let the translator know in advance. Clear communication is key to avoiding misunderstandings and ensuring that the final translation meets your expectations. By providing comprehensive information upfront, you can help streamline the translation process and minimize the risk of errors.

    Secondly, review the translated transcript carefully. Once you receive the translated transcript, take the time to review it thoroughly for any errors or inconsistencies. Compare the translated version to the original transcript and make sure that all the information is accurately translated. Pay close attention to names, dates, course titles, and grades. If you notice any mistakes, don't hesitate to contact the translation service and request a revision. It's always better to catch errors early on rather than submitting a flawed translation. A careful review can help you avoid potential problems and ensure that your translated transcript is accurate and reliable. Remember, the accuracy of your translated transcript is crucial for your academic and professional pursuits, so it's worth taking the time to ensure that it's perfect.
